Essence Of Maximalism As Home Decor
Maximalism is not achieved through clutter, but through deliberate layering, blending, and showcasing what is loved. Whereas minimalism celebrates simplification, maximalism favors abundance, exuberance, and creativity. Every single piece in a maximalist home decor setting serves a purpose and tells a story, ranging from vibrant wall art for living room spaces to bold modular kitchen designs that blend style with functionality.

Tips to Embrace Maximalist Interior Design
Let us give you quite interesting and more actionable tips to get your hands on maximalism.
Kickstart with Wall Decor
Walls are the utmost saviour of every home, so just start with walls. Choose some striking wall art for the living room, as well as your go-to bedroom. You can also paint something huge, as per your preference, maintain a gallery wall or bold wallpapers, as these will give your room an immediate maximalist look.
Mix and Match Furniture
The vital advantage of going maximalism is, you don’t want to go matching-matching. You can have a mix-and-match home decor items. So, here’s a pro tip by our expert designer of Pune: have a vintage armchair, a trending sofa bed, with different textures like velvet and leather. All together adds personality to your home.
Embrace Color and Pattern
Don’t shy away from bold hues or intricate patterns. Whether it’s a vibrant modular kitchen backsplash or a patterned rug, these elements can anchor a maximalist style.
Showcase Collections
Whether it’s books, figurines, or maximalist art pieces, displaying your collections can turn your space into a reflection of your identity.
Play with Lighting
Chandeliers, floor lamps, and fairy lights are great for adding layers of lighting. These elements enhance the warmth and depth of maximalist interiors.

Incorporating Design Maximalism in Key Areas
Living Room
The living room is the heart of your home. Use patterned throw pillows, layered rugs, and wall art for living room spaces that pop to catch attention. Don't hesitate to explore and experiment with maximalist home decor.
Kitchen
Maximalist kitchens support bold modular kitchen designs with colorful cabinetry and eclectic backsplashes as well as open shelvings that display beautiful dishes.
Bedroom
Curtains and rugs bring life to a space, so using rich textures and patterns will enhance the feeling of a maximalist style bedroom. With ample layering done, it can feel like a luxurious retreat.
Common Myths About Maximalism
- Cluttered in Reality: It is about balancing and curation, not chaos.
- Expensive in Reality: A secret tip unveils here, is you can curate with thrift finds, DIY ideas, and strategic investments for a maximalist look.
- Overwhelming in Reality: Not at all, when balancing comes as ruler.
